Output 6615e420f8057e15df62e409337edfbe7187dacc832ff935290017b5a5733aef:18

value
40584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3586294dd70d31660c3e8be06bf422503f02273e OP_EQUAL
address
36a2TQQYXWEZY27KH6dBDaSgj6i4oyn4EB
transaction
6615e420f8057e15df62e409337edfbe7187dacc832ff935290017b5a5733aef
spent
true